The protagonist is Jung-seok (played by Gang Dong-won), a former Marine Corps captain who managed to escape Korea on the day the outbreak began. However, he carries the heavy burden of guilt, having failed to save his sister and nephew during their escape. Living as a refugee in Hong Kong, he is offered a dangerous mission: return to the quarantined peninsula to retrieve a truck filled with $20 million in cash.
The lack of a Train To Busan 2 Tamil version boils down to distribution rights and market economics. While Train to Busan (2016) was a massive hit in the international circuit, Peninsula received mixed reviews compared to its predecessor. Distributors in South India likely calculated that the cost of producing a high-quality Tamil dub (which requires famous voice artists and studio time) was not worth the return on investment (ROI) for the Tamil audience.
